The M5 was forced to close in both directions following a horror crash on the motorway, earlier today.
An air ambulance landed on the road as police and emergency services rushed to the scene. Traffic was stopped in both directions on the M5 between J6 for Worcester and J5 for Droitwich.
The major disruption was due to a "police-led incident", although the exact details were not clear.
